ICJIA | Illinois Criminal Justice Information Authority
The Authority brings together key leaders from the justice system and the public to identify critical issues facing the criminal justice system in Illinois, and to propose and evaluate policies, programs, and legislation that address those issues. The agency also works to ensure the criminal justice system in Illinois is efficient and effective. The Authority’s specific powers and duties are detailed in the Illinois Criminal Justice Information Act.

The Public Interest - The Public Interest was a quarterly public policy journal founded by the New York intellectuals Daniel Bell and Irving
The Public Interest was a quarterly public policy journal founded by the New York intellectuals Daniel Bell and Irving Kristol in 1965.
